VA Northern California Health Care System is looking for a full-time Nephrologist to join our VA team providing nephrology and dialysis unit services for Veteran and Department of Defense (DoD) beneficiaries at the David Grant USAF Medical Center (DGMC), Travis AFB, CA. The position encompasses the breadth of clinical care, including on-call inpatient consultation, outpatient clinic and outpatient dialysis rounding. Teaching is an integral part of our mission. Duties will include, but are not limited to:
Direct patient care in the inpatient and outpatient settings.
Provide diagnosis and treatment of diseases to adult patients presenting with illnesses and injuries relating to kidney conditions that are applicable to his/her practice, training, experience, or current competence.
Perform minor procedures per credentialing and privileging approvals.
Proficiency in peritoneal dialysis and teaching experience required
Order routine diagnostic imaging studies and labs.
Participate actively in performance improvement and attend assigned meetings or process action teams. Work collaboratively with other specialties.

Pay: Competitive salary, annual performance bonus, regular salary increases Paid Time Off: 50-55 days of annual paid time offer per year (26 days of annual leave, 13 days of sick leave, 11 paid Federal holidays per year and possible 5 day paid absence for CME) Retirement: Traditional federal pension (5 years vesting) and federal 401K with up to 5% in contributions by VA Insurance: Federal health/vision/dental/term life/long-term care (many federal insurance programs can be carried into retirement) Licensure: 1 full and unrestricted license from any US State or territory CME: Possible $1,000 per year reimbursement Malpractice: Free liability protection with tail coverage provided Contract: No Physician Employment Contract and no significant restriction on moonlighting

Providing Health Care for Veterans: The Veterans Health Administration is America’s largest integrated health care system, providing care at 1,255 health care facilities, including 170 medical centers and 1,074 outpatient sites of care of varying complexity (VHA outpatient clinics), serving 9 million enrolled Veterans each year.
